Neuralink and Beyond

Neuralink, founded by Elon Musk, is often cited as a pioneer in the advancement of neural interfaces. Although their primary goal is to treat neurological diseases and potentially allow humans to merge with artificial intelligence, the practical applications for leadership and management are equally revolutionary. Neuralink is developing devices that could one day allow users to control digital environments purely through thought, without the need for physical commands.

Improving Programmer Concentration

In the technology sector, brain interfaces are explored for their potential to improve programmers' concentration. Tech companies are testing these interfaces in software development environments where the ability to focus without distraction is crucial. For example, pilot studies have shown that brain interfaces can help reduce coding errors by monitoring concentration levels and signaling to programmers when to take optimal breaks to maximize efficiency without overworking.

Ethical and Logistical Challenges

However, the use of such technologies is not without challenges. Privacy concerns are paramount, as direct access to thoughts or emotional states of employees raises serious ethical questions. Additionally, dependence on technology for cognitive functions could lead to disparities in the workplace between those who have access to this technology and those who do not.
